Web30 de nov. de 2015 · Strontium chloride Sr-89 is a radiopharmaceutical agent used for the relief of bone pain in patients with painful skeletal metastases. Strontium chloride (Sr … Strontium-89 was first synthesized in 1937 by D. W. Stewart et al. at the University of Michigan; it was synthesized via irradiation of stable strontium ( Sr) with deuterons. Biological properties and applications of strontium-89 were studied for the first time by Belgian scientist Charles Pecher. Pecher filed a patent in May … Ver más Strontium-89 ( Sr ) is a radioactive isotope of strontium produced by nuclear fission, with a half-life of 50.57 days. It undergoes β decay into yttrium-89. Strontium-89 has an application in medicine.
